Maple Mustard Lamb Loin With Potatoes

Total Time: 1 hr 15 mins Preparation Time: 15 mins Cook Time: 1 hr

Ingredients

  • Servings: 8
  • 1/4 cup olive oil
  • 1/4 cup dijon mustard
  • 3 tablespoons pure maple syrup
  • 2 tablespoons fresh rosemary, chopped
  • 6 rosemary sprigs
  • 4 garlic cloves, smashed and peeled
  • 1 -4 lb boneless lamb loin (12 inches long)
  • 8 ounces lean bacon
  • 6 baking potatoes, cut into small pieces
  • roasting string

Recipe

  • 1 to do the night before or 4 hours in advance:.
  • 2 in a large ziploc bag combine the olive oil, mustard, chopped rosemary, maple syrup and garlic. place lamb loin in bag and marinate at least 4 hours.
  • 3 to bake:.
  • 4 preheat oven to 375.
  • 5 place 6 sprigs of rosemary on bottom of roast pan.
  • 6 place roast string over the rosemary.
  • 7 remove loin from ziploc and place on top of string/rosemary.
  • 8 lay bacon across the top of lamb.
  • 9 tie string over the roast keeping the bacon in place.
  • 10 put potatoes on sides of lamb, drizzle with olive oil and salt and pepper to taste.
  • 11 roast for 1 hour uncovered and rest for 10 minutes before serving.
